12 Ethanol Plants to Install Emissions Controls [USA] - Twelve ethanol plants in Minnesota have agreed to install new pollution control equipment to slash their emissions of volatile organic compounds and carbon monoxide. (Cat Lazaroff, Environment News Service, 3 Oct. 2002)
EPA in first steps on ethanol emissions [USA] - Environmental Protecton Agency officials suggested measures this week to reduce toxic byproducts from ethanol plants after presenting evidence that many of the plants may be creating hazardous environmental pollutants. (Eric Noe, Reuters, 5 June 2002)
EPA probing emissions from ethanol industry [USA] - WSJ - Federal regulators are investigating emissions produced by the nation's ethanol industry over concerns it may be violating the Clean Air Act (Reuters, 8 May 2002)
